Class Analysis and Contemporary AustraliaJaneen Baxter Macmillan Education AU, 1991 - 394 pages A systematic overview of the class structure of contemporary Australia which sets out to examine, in the light of new empirical evidence, many of the assumptions that are often held about the existence of class and the significance of class divisions in Australian society. |
